  • Each pair making up the amygdala consists of three nuclei. (differencebetween.net)
  • The three divisions of the amygdala are the centromedial nuclei, cortical-like nuclei, and basolateral nuclei. (differencebetween.net)
  • The regions described as amygdala nuclei encompass several structures of the cerebrum with distinct connectional and functional characteristics in humans and other animals. (wikipedia.org)

  • Amongst female subjects, the amygdala reaches its full growth potential approximately 1.5 years before the peak of male development. (wikipedia.org)
  • The left amygdala reaches its developmental peak approximately 1.5-2 years prior to the right amygdala. (wikipedia.org)
